KColorChooser
Photos & Graphics
KColorChooser is an open-source color picker and palette editing tool for Linux desktop environments using the KDE framework. It allows users to select colors visually and integrate with other applications.

qSnap
Office & Productivity
qSnap is a screenshot and annotation tool for Windows. It allows you to take screenshots, draw on them, add text and shapes, blur sensitive information, and share or export the annotated images.
